EGG-LAYING.
Press Association. CHRISTCHURCH, September 2. The winter tost (May 19th to August 31st) in the egg-laying competition at Lincoln College was concluded on Saturday and was won by Air. W. Knight’s black Orpingtons, with 412 eggs, Mr. T. Kennedy’s silver Wyanaottes being second with 403 and Air. Allen Petrie’s white Leghorns third with 399. Tho prizes amount to £lO.
